The Blackhawk USB560 JTAG emulator(Rev. E) is the third generation of the most widely used USB XDS560-class emulator, first introduced by Blackhawk in 2002. The USB560 supports all of the advanced capabilities of Texas Instruments latest DSPs. These capabilities include high-speed Real-Time Data Exchange HS-RTDX™, lightning speed downloads and Advanced Event Triggering to quickly find and fix real-time software problems.

The compact JTAG emulator pod features a variable TCK (timing clock) up to 50 MHz and supports voltages from 5v down to 0.5v to support TI low-voltage device roadmap. Software compatible with all versions of Code Composer Studio™ (CCStudio) integrated development environment (IDE) v2.2 and later. Drivers are provided for Windows® 2000, XP and Vista. Additionally, 64-bit drivers are available for XP Pro x64 and Vista x64. All driver updates are available for download free-of-charge from our website.

The Blackhawk USB560 JTAG Emulator supports TMS320, TMS470 (ARM®) and OMAP™ families including the DaVinci™ platform. The USB560 JTAG Emulator is also compatible with the Code Composer Studio Flash-burner utility.

Features
High-speed RTDX™ support with data rates of over 2 MB/sec
Compact pod with power and USB status indicator LED's
High-speed USB2.0 (480 Mbits/sec) port
Flexible 12 inch high-speed micro coax JTAG cable with 20-pin cTI (Compact TI) header
Auto-sensing low I/O voltage support down to 0.5v
Real-time, non-intrusive Advanced Event Triggering capability
Windows Plug 'n Play Installation
Up to 100 times faster than XDS510 emulators
Full Code Composer Studio IDE compatibility for versions 2.2 and later
  System Requirements
PC running Windows® 2000, XP or Vista
Code Composer Studio IDE v2.2 or later
Free USB1.1 or 2.0 port (2.0 recommended)
CD-ROM drive for driver installation
TI DSP platforms: TMS320C6000, TMS320C5000, TMS320C2000, OMAP, DaVinci
